Osia Jeevaratnam

Project Manager, Infrastructure And Energy at CAMH

Osia Jeevaratnam is a Project Manager specializing in Infrastructure and Energy at the Centre for Addiction and Mental Health (CAMH) since August 2020. Previously, Osia held the role of Assistant Facility Manager at ENGIE Services North America, contributing to a P3 project, and served as a Project Manager and Facility Engineer at Honeywell from January 2013 to April 2019, focusing on contract compliance and the development of quality control systems across Canada. Osia also gained experience as a FastLane Technician at Ford Motor Company from August 2009 to October 2010. Educational qualifications include a Bachelor of Technology in Automotive Engineering Technology from McMaster University and a diploma in Automotive Service Technician from Centennial College.

The Centre for Addiction and Mental Health (CAMH) is Canada's largest mental health and addiction teaching hospital. CAMH combines clinical care, research, education, policy development and health promotion to help transform the lives of people affected by mental health and addiction issues.
